
Hung Yen (VNA) – Hung Yen province's Department of Public Security said on January 30 that its Investigation Security Agency has launched criminal proceedingsagainst and arrested a local man for the charge of "making, storing,distributing, or disseminating information, documents, and items against theState of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am" under Article 117 of the PenalCode.
The arrestee is Pham Van Cho, born in 1964, residing in Lac Dao commune of Van Lam district.
Earlier, the department’s cyber security division and hi-techcrime prevention and control found that from 2020 to November 2023, Cho managedand used Facebook accounts "Cho Pham Van" and "Nguyen MinhTan" to make livestreams, post, and share many video clips defaming theParty and State and insulting leaders.
The acts are violations prescribed in point C, clause 1, Article 16 of theLaw on Cyber Security.
At the Investigation Security Agency, Cho admitted that he was themanager of the Facebook accounts and used them to broadcast livestreams, andpost and share video clips that seriously offended the Party, State, andleaders.
The case is under further investigation in accordance with the law./.
